MARCH MAGAZINE MADNESS~MARCH MAGAZINE MADNESS
In an effort to grow our paper recycling program and raise some additional money, Student Council is asking for your support. From March 7-25 we are trying to double our paper intake from March 2010. We are especially trying to collect any magazines due to the extra weight, but we are also still collecting newspapers, junk mail, catalogs, file folder, phone books and any other type of paper.
Also if you work at a business that does not currently have a recycling program, we are inviting you to bring your office paper to our Paper Retriever bin. You would be helping Student Council and the environment. The bin is located at Pine School by the playground. You can drop off your papers anytime, including evenings and weekends.

4Th R is a tutoring program for sixth graders at Pine School in collaboration
with North Olmsted High School students. Two days a week high school students
come to Pine and help sixth graders work on their homework, study for a test,
or review and practice some of their math and reading skills for state
achievement tests. It has been a successful program at Pine for several years
with high school and intermediate students working in cooperation to improve
academic goals.
